Responsibility
- Assist the Restaurant Manager in overseeing daily operations, including opening/closing procedures, staff scheduling, and shift coordination.
- Ensure exceptional customer service by addressing guest inquiries, resolving complaints, and maintaining a welcoming atmosphere.
- Monitor food and beverage quality, presentation, and consistency in alignment with authentic Japanese culinary standards.
- Train, mentor, and supervise front-of-house staff, including servers, hosts, and bartenders, to uphold service excellence.
- Manage inventory levels, place orders with suppliers, and control costs to optimize profitability.
- Collaborate with the kitchen team to ensure timely and accurate order fulfillment during peak hours.
- Implement and enforce health, safety, and hygiene protocols in compliance with local regulations.
- Contribute to marketing initiatives, such as promotions, events, and social media campaigns to drive customer engagement.
Qualifications
- Minimum 2-3 years of experience in a supervisory or management role within the hospitality industry, preferably in a Japanese or fine-dining restaurant.
-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ills with a customer-first mindset.
- In-depth knowledge of Japanese cuisine, service etiquette, and cultural nuances (e.g., sake pairing, tea service).
- Proven ability to manage high-volume operations in a fast-paced environment while maintaining composure.
- Fluency in English (written and verbal); proficiency in Japanese or Indonesian is a plus.
- Flexibility to work evenings, weekends, and holidays as required by the restaurantâs operating hours.
- Basic understanding of POS systems, inventory management software, and Microsoft Office/Google Workspace.
- Diploma or degree in Hospitality Management, Culinary Arts, or a related field is advantageous.
